From the moment I first saw the trailer I knew this was going to be a show unlike any other. Watching it was one of the best decisions I ever made. From episode 1 all the way to episode 13, Hilda kept me hooked and wanting to see more. From amazing and lovable characters, smooth and breathtaking animation, a cast and crew that really brings the show to life and a feeling of nostalgia that you just cannot begin to comprehend. A lot of people are saying Hilda has many similarities to Gravity Falls and Over the Garden Wall. I don't. The show is first off based on Luke Pearson's Hildafolk comics that have been out since 2010, well before GF and OTGW ever aired. The shows are all original in their own way and I feel people need to watch shows without comparing them to others. It makes the viewing experience better and more enjoyable. Hilda is amazing in its own way. In some ways it did things better then Gravity Falls and OTGW did. I could go on about how amazing Hilda is but quite frankly, watching it for yourself and making your own decision on how good it is, is better then reading reviews from random people online. And be sure to read the original Hilda books as well. Luke Pearson's world will suck you in make you smile. Such is the life of an adventurer.
